Junkie Wings

  1. preheat peanut oil to 375 Fahrenheit
  2. Mix the wing sauce and lemon pepper in a bowl, set aside.
  3. Cut the wings at the joint to maximize space in the deep dryer.
  4. Place the wings in the dryer one at a time.
  5. Deep fry the wings at 375F for 7 minutes.
  6. Remove wings from deep dryer and allow oil to drain for about 30 seconds.
  7. Place wings in Junkie Sauce and coat evenly.
  8. Garnish wings with lemon zest and parsley, plate and serve.

butter milk, clove garlic, black pepper, salt, chili sauce, lemon pepper, sauce, peanut oil, chicken
